SA men charged after NSW ice seizure
AAP
Two South Australian men have been charged after police allegedly seized $76,000-worth of the drug ice in far west NSW.
Police say a motel room search in Broken Hill, after they stopped a vehicle in the city on Friday morning, uncovered 76 grams of ice.
The two 38-year-old men were arrested and charged with supplying an indictable quantity of a prohibited drug. They were refused bail to appear at Broken Hill Local Court on Saturday.
